But...if you have access to a php.ini file you can do this: error_log = /var/log/php-scripts.log According to rinogo's comment: If you're using cPanel, the master log file you're probably looking for Get started now 310.841.5500 About Us Help Back to Top ^ Hosting Compare Plans WordPress Hosting Shared Hosting VPS Hosting Website Builder Enterprise Solutions Overview Managed Amazon Cloud WordPress for Cloud A newline is not automatically added to the end of the message string. 4 message is sent directly to the SAPI logging handler. helps keep your code clean as you can add as many adit calls as you want and the configure deals with them

// binary values

Php Error Log Ubuntu

Domain Access Log  /usr/local/cpanel/logs/access_log Domain Error Log  /usr/local/cpanel/logs/error_log Overview All connections to the Web server and requests for files that were not found on the server are registered in log files. destination The destination. And you can view tail like this: tail -f /var/log/apache2/error.log share|improve this answer edited Jul 13 '15 at 7:41 arghtype 1,83761525 answered Jul 6 '15 at 8:33 ediston 9619 add a

www-data) fixed the problem. add a note Error Handling Functions debug_backtrace debug_print_backtrace error_clear_last error_get_last error_log error_reporting restore_error_handler restore_exception_handler set_error_handler set_exception_handler trigger_error user_error Copyright © 2001-2016 The PHP Group My Contact I hope that helps to answer your question! Specifies additional headers, like From, Cc, and Bcc. Php.ini Error_log Viewing the logs The log data is best viewed in a plain text editor.

Am I looking the wrong place? Php.ini Error Log Why does Fleur say "zey, ze" instead of "they, the" in Harry Potter? The location of the error log file itself can be set manually in the php.ini file. here Specifies the destination of the error message.

You can enable the error_reporting by removing the ( ; ) from in front to the line. Php Error Log Centos To get to the Control Panel, click on Domains, then on the Control Panel link next to your domain. Find the Error handling and logging section of the php.ini file. This is the default option. 1 message is sent by email to the address in the destination parameter.

Php.ini Error Log

Sometimes when developing PHP scripts you may want to turn specific errors Off or On. Browse other questions tagged error-handling or ask your own question. Php Error Log Ubuntu Kindest regards, Arnel C. Php Logarithm How to handle unintentional innuendos Should I use the formal form (~ます) on the buttons of an app?

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the check over here The default value doesn't give a full path, only a file name, I don't know where this path resolves to normally. Reply Arn Staff 35,172 Points 2015-01-22 10:01 am Hello Anant, Thanks for the question.

Does it still log all errors although i changed the path to log errors (outside document root) ? Thanks much! Shared hosts are often storing log files in your root directory /log subfolder. Is the ritual of killing an animal as offering to Maa Kali correct?

locate php.ini. Php Debug Log asked 3 years ago viewed 25109 times active 3 years ago Related 1Unprettyfied SSL error message?2crossplatformui error in Mint 113Capture screen content for error parsing4why bash increment: `n=0;((n++));` return error?-1Why to Be sure your browser's pop-up blocker is disabled for your Plesk Control Panel.

It might be in /etc/httpd/conf.d/<- as "other" or "extra".

While using this site, you agree to have read and accepted our terms of use, cookie and privacy policy.
One really cannot assume that a package's name is consistent across distros. –chelmertz May 14 '13 at 9:07 22 FYI to Googlers - If you're using cPanel, the master log Please enable JavaScript to submit this form. The code looks like the following. It could be listed as either /var/log/httpd/error_log or /var/log/apache2/error_log but it might also be listed as simply logs/error_log.

Generally, on all production web servers displaying error to end users via a web browser is turned off using php.ini file settings. share|improve this answer answered May 6 '15 at 18:55 community wiki ThorSummoner add a comment| up vote 6 down vote It can also be /var/log/apache2/error.log if you are in google compute Viewing the logs The log data is best viewed in a plain text editor. Disproving Euler proposition by brute force in C Why are rainbows brighter through polarized glass?

System Calls From C Code How to find the distance between 2 regions? For some reason, if the log file already exists and it's 0 KB, PHP will try to re-create the log file and fail in the process. So the only way to modify them is by adding the following lines to your config.php file, just before the last line (the one containing a single'?>' only): ini_set ('display_errors', 'on'); for example it may be an fpm package of debian running on nginx. –n611x007 Aug 24 '15 at 9:32 add a comment| up vote 69 down vote Try phpinfo() and check

What ever folder you want your logs deposited to, don't create the log file yourself, let php do it for you. The system logger is not supported on Windows 95. share|improve this answer answered Dec 3 '12 at 13:26 Brian Marshall 1414 1 I read that too and found a command to reveal error_log but when I looked for it Else, if you have installed it from repository, you will find it at /var/log/apache2/error_log.You can set the path in your php.ini also and verify it by invoking phpinfo().

See the following. Tutorials, references, and examples are constantly reviewed to avoid errors, but we cannot warrant full correctness of all content. PostgreSQL function not executed when called from inside CTE Do editors know how many papers I am refereeing on the same platform?